General info about the disc, for the people who don't know anything about it:
It is about 1 hour long, and has animated menu screens, and short 3D rendered intro for a bit of fun.
The beginning is in the dealer room and lasts about 10 minutes.
The majority of the footage is of the main stage where Terry English and William Hope answer questions (with John Shadwell showing up in Marine armour in the Terry part).
It finishes off with a couple of minutes of the signings, followed by the credits.
Note: The sound is quite low on the talks, as the sound wasn't very loud in the room. If you turn the volume up on your TV you should be okay. I find it okay, and can hear what they are saying.
The picture quality isn't brilliant, as it's from an analogue camcorder and was captured through a composite lead; all I had at the time.
